Understanding the Evolution of Memory Assistance Technologies
Over the past decade, advancements in digital health technologies have fundamentally transformed approaches to cognitive support, especially in the realm of neurodegenerative conditions such as Alzheimer’s and other forms of dementia. Traditional methods—like memory notebooks or reminder alarms—have given way to sophisticated, user-centric tools that integrate seamlessly into daily routines. These innovations are increasingly rooted in evidence-based design principles, ensuring that they are both effective and accessible for diverse user populations.
The Critical Need for Reliable Memory Aids
Memory impairment remains one of the most pervasive and distressing symptoms associated with neurodegenerative diseases. According to recent data from the World Health Organization, an estimated 55 million people worldwide are living with dementia, a number projected to triple by 2050. As the aging population expands, so does the imperative for innovative solutions that can delay functional decline, improve independence, and enhance quality of life.
Effective memory aids must therefore transcend mere reminders; they need to be intuitive, personalized, and capable of integrating with users’ evolving cognitive capacities. This necessity has propelled the development of digital applications that leverage modern technologies such as artificial intelligence, behavioral heuristics, and user-experience design aimed at maximizing engagement and adherence.
Emerging Industry Insights: From Reminders to Cognitive Engagement
Recent studies highlight that mobile and tablet-based memory aids outperform traditional systems by improving user compliance and cognitive engagement. For example, a 2022 clinical trial published in The Journal of Medical Internet Research demonstrated that older adults and individuals with mild cognitive impairment (MCI) who used adaptive digital memory tools showed significant improvements in daily functioning over a 12-week period.
| Feature | Traditional Methods | Digital Memory Aids |
|---|---|---|
| Ease of Customization | Limited, static | Highly adaptable with AI personalization |
| User Engagement | Passive reminders | Interactive, multimedia content |
| Data Tracking | Manual, inconsistent | Automated, real-time analytics |
| Accessibility | Limited to physical devices or paper | Mobile-responsive, customizable interfaces |
Designing for the Future: The User Experience and Ethical Dimensions
As the industry advances, user experience (UX) remains paramount. Cognitive aids must be designed with empathy, ensuring usability for older adults with varying levels of tech literacy. Features like voice command integration, simplified interfaces, and personalized alert systems exemplify best practices backed by cognitive ergonomics research.
“Effective digital memory aids not only serve as mnemonic devices but also foster autonomy, dignity, and social connectedness,” emphasizes Dr. Elena Ramos, a leading neuropsychologist specializing in assistive technology.
However, along with technological innovation, ethical considerations—such as data privacy, consent, and accessibility—must guide development. The sensitive nature of health data mandates rigorous standards for security and transparency, especially as these tools collect and analyze personal cognitive metrics.
